Saldremos de Hobart en dirección este y luego seguiremos la costa norte. Viajamos a través de las ciudades costeras de Orford y Swansea mientras nos dirigimos al Parque Nacional Freycinet. Freycinet es uno de los primeros Parques Nacionales de Tasmania, famoso por sus ricos e impresionantes paisajes costeros. Las Montañas de Granito Rosado forman el telón de fondo de bahías solitarias, aguas cristalinas, playas de arena blanca, vida silvestre local y sorprendentes senderos para caminar.
A medida que ingresamos al área de Freycinet, tenemos una breve parada en Freycinet Marine Farm para cualquier persona interesada en las ostras locales frescas de las aguas prístinas circundantes.
Caminamos en grupo hasta el mirador de Wineglass Bay; esta es una caminata cuesta arriba moderada de alrededor de 60 minutos. Una vez en la cima, serás recompensado con la mundialmente famosa vista de Wineglass Bay y el Parque Nacional Freycinet que lo rodea. Disfrute el momento, disfrute de las vistas y deje que nuestros guías turísticos lo ayuden con esas fotografías tan buscadas. La caminata hasta Wineglass Bay Lookout es una de las grandes caminatas cortas de Tasmania y requiere buena movilidad y condición física adecuada. Son 1,3 km cuesta arriba, antes de regresar cuesta abajo.
Desde el mirador, tiene la opción de regresar al inicio de la caminata con nuestro guía turístico, o para los excursionistas entusiastas, puede optar por pasar el resto de su tiempo completando la caminata hasta la playa de Wineglass Bay. Caminata de regreso a la playa de Wineglass Bay: esta es una caminata de regreso de 2,5 horas y se requiere un estado físico moderado. Nuestro tour tiene suficiente tiempo para que hagas la caminata completa hasta la playa de Wineglass Bay y regreses. Una vez en la playa, puede disfrutar de su almuerzo en este impresionante entorno, sumergirse en el agua para nadar o pasear por las arenas blancas. Este es uno de los paseos más gratificantes de Tasmania en un lugar verdaderamente impresionante.
Si prefiere caminar hasta el mirador y regresar, esta es la opción de caminata más corta, luego regresará desde el mirador con nuestro guía turístico y explorará otras áreas del Parque Nacional Freycinet. Visite Honeymoon Bay, Cape Tourville Lighthouse, Great Short Walk y Sleepy Bay.
Nos reagrupamos listos para el viaje de regreso. Nuestra última parada en la costa este es la impresionante bodega Devil's Corner, donde tendrá tiempo para disfrutar de la magnífica vista. En el lugar puede disfrutar de una degustación de vinos, pizza al horno de leña, mariscos frescos y ostras de Freycinet Marine Farm y helados, todo disponible por cuenta propia en el día. .
Luego continúa hacia Launceston y llega alrededor de las 6:00 p.m.

I did this tour as part of the 'Big Three' three-day tour from Hobart to Launceston. The weather on the day of the tour was not ideal, lightly raining nearly the entire day, but I still had a lot of fun. The day started early picking everyone up from their hotels before making a quick stop shortly outside of Hobart for anyone needing to purchase lunch to take with them for the day. We made one additional stop along a beach before getting to the Freycinet National Park. From there, we had three options of walks, a short walk to a cafe/lunch spot, a walk to Wineglass Bay Lookout (a 45-minute uphill walk), or the option to extend your walk to the actual sands of Wineglass Bay (approximately 2.5 hours). Normally, I would have chosen the longer walk, but given the weather was rainy, and the guide advised there were a couple of sections of the walk to be careful on, our group of four opted for the walk to the lookout. Two of the members of the group stopped halfway to the lookout before turning to head towards the van as it was an uphill climb and a bit too much for them. After taking in the views overlooking Wineglass Bay, we headed to Honeymoon Bay and did the Cape Tourville Lighthouse Walk. The description says you stop at the Freycinet Marine Farm for oysters, but we did not, so maybe that is a seasonal thing. We made one last stop for coffee/snacks/ice cream before arriving in Launceston. Overall, the day was long and tiring, but fun, and I learned a lot from the guides.
